OpenAI has joined Anthropic in calling for an international organization to oversee AI development, citing the need to slow down frontier model development if necessary. The company's CEO, Sam Altman, met with Congressional leadership to discuss the formation of such an organization, which would enable coordinated action to ensure societal resilience, safety, and alignment with AI development. OpenAI believes AI's self-improving potential will determine the pace of progress in the next few years. The company is working towards building an "automated AI researcher" and providing personal AGI to everyone on Earth. This call for oversight comes after Anthropic expressed similar concerns about the risks of unregulated AI development.
